Conference

ACS National Meeting & Exposition

March 16-20, 2014

Dallas, TX

American Chemical Society (ACS)

Finnegan will sponsor the Division of Chemistry and the Law programming at the 247th ACS National Meeting & Exposition. Finnegan attorneys Krista Bianco, Adriana Burgy, Justin Hasford, and Jen Roscetti will present “Best Practices in Identifying, Protecting, and Managing Your Intellectual Property Portfolio” and “Hot Topics in Chemical Patent Law.” The conference will take place at The Kay Bailey Hutchinson Convention Center in Dallas, Texas.
